Skip to main content
Question

How Do I Get UTM Data from App into Hubspot?

  • 28 August 2024
  • 7 replies
  • 44 views

Hi there - I am having issues getting attribution data from users who sign up on my web app (Source) into my Hubspot Destination. The app is capturing UTM parameters, but when that data gets fed into Hubspot from Segment, the Original Source in Hubspot is simply “INTEGRATION” and Original Source Drilldown 1 is “Twilio - Segment.” Ideally, I should be able to populate Hubspot’s native “Original Source” field with where these users are coming from (Organic, Paid Search, etc).

Essentially, I’m unable to see where my web app signups are coming from because Segment is not passing this data correctly. We have the Hubspot Tracking Code installed on our app through Google Tag Manager, but finding this is still not working.

This seems very basic but unfortunately I’m completely stuck. Any ideas?

A few questions to get some context around the issue:

  • Are y’all using the “Classic”, “Web (Actions)”, or “Cloud (Actions)” Destination?
    • If either of the latter two, what mapping settings are available for UTM parameters?
  • Are you able to see UTM parameters in the Source debugger?
    • If so, would you share an example or screenshot?

  • We are using the “Cloud (Actions)” Destination.
    • It doesn’t look like there are any default mapping settings available for UTM parameters within the Cloud (Actions) destination). However, there is an “Other Properties” mapping option thought that allows you to select an “Event Variable” and map to a “Key Name.
  • We are getting some UTM parameters (see photo)
  •  

 

A few questions to get some context around the issue:

  • Are y’all using the “Classic”, “Web (Actions)”, or “Cloud (Actions)” Destination?
    • If either of the latter two, what mapping settings are available for UTM parameters?
  • Are you able to see UTM parameters in the Source debugger?
    • If so, would you share an example or screenshot?

 


And, just to verify, you are looking at the “Raw” (not “Pretty”) version of the event, which should look like this:

Also, this filter in the Debugger should make it easy to find events with campaign data:

 


I am seeing UTM data come in (see my photo above).


Is there additional configuration needed inside HubSpot to receive the UTM parameters? I see that there are both forms and campaigns that can be set up, but that’s the end of my visibility into the issue. Has anyone else had experience with HubSpot? Their documentation doesn’t seem (to me) to point to enabling ingestion of outside events with marketing data.


Hey@Christy Puller - you may need to use the custom properties field and have it pre-mapped in HubSpot. Even if it’s mapped in Segment that looks to be a pre-req. 


Hey@Christy Puller - you may need to use the custom properties field and have it pre-mapped in HubSpot. Even if it’s mapped in Segment that looks to be a pre-req. 

I am not using a Hubspot form for this. Users sign up in our app (not on Hubspot forms) and then we are passing and mapping user data over to Hubspot. However we are having issues when trying to pass UTM data from these user profiles.


Reply